T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2016 in Review
8 of the 3,749 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in A T & T CORP (NEW) (T) for Q2 2016, worth a combined $14.4M — up 12% from $12.9M a quarter earlier.
Buyers outnumbered sellers: 1 fund opened new T positions and 0 closed out — a net gain of 1 holder — while 1 added to existing stakes and 4 trimmed.
The largest buyer was Norman Fields Gottscho Capital Management, opening a new position worth an estimated $211K. The largest seller was Blue Bell Private Wealth Management, cutting an estimated $99.8K.
